As I document our journey of fertility struggles and treatments I will probably use a variety of abbreviations that may be new or odd. This is what I mean:
- TTC-Trying To Conceive
- RE-Reproductive Endocrinologist a.k.a fertility specialist
- DH-Dear Husband
- DS-Dear Son
- DD-Dear Daughter
- MIL-Mother In Law
- SIL-Sister In Law
- BFP-Big Fat Positive (positive pregnancy test)
- BFN-Big Fat Negative (negative pregnancy test)
- IVF-In Vitro Fertilization, a fertility treatment that using sperm and an egg to create an embryo that is then implanted into the uterus
- IUI- Intrauterine Insemination (commonly called artificial insemination)
- PGS or CCS-Pre Genetic Screening or Comprehensive Chromosome Screening, checking the baby for possible chromosomal abnormalities before conception
- PCOS-Poly Cystic Ovarian Syndrome. A syndrome characterized by high testosterone, irregular cycles, and polycystic ovaries (multiple cysts lining the ovaries)
- HSG-Hysterosalpingography, this is a series of x-rays with a contrast dye to see if my Fallopian tubes are blocked.
- MFM-Maternal Fetal Medicine, this refers to a doctor who specializes in high risk pregnancies. Their ultrasound equipment is more precise than a normal OB and their techs tend to be better trained.
